Abstract

Pregnant and lactating women continue to have some of the lowest levels of vaccine uptake despite COVID-19 vaccine recommendations. It is important to consider why COVID-19 vaccine uptake has lagged counter to robust evidence on vaccine benefits, including concerns about vaccine safety and effectiveness. In this column, I present a summary of research findings, limitations, future directions, and a compilation of guidelines and recommendations from professional and governmental organizations.
